Vegas=live straddles and also they allow mississippi straddles which are straddles allowed anywhere on the table. The action if someone straddles the btn goes sb first then bb then utg. It is maybe +ev in nl games not sure about limit games. West coast most all of them are blind raises. Oaks is straddle, bay 101 might be but i am not sure.
Best part of straddling is making fun of the nits not doing it with you.
Most places in Vegas don't allow Mississippi straddles. Rio did last year (technically just allowed button straddles not Mississippi straddles) in both NL and PLO, I wouldn't ever do it in limit unless I was drinking/having fun/desperately trying to juice up a nittish game.

One thing I have seen a few times is a person not chopping "this hand" because they finally got a good hand and they have been getting nothing for a while. Obviously this is horrible etiquette but I have seen it, although it was a low limit game. But you will see people look at their hand before deciding to chop, which is just rude, imo.
Another thing you'll see, and it's a goofy social thing to do, is showing the hand that you ended up chopping. You get to say silly things like, "You had me out kicked", when you show 72 and they show 82.

+1 to whoever said that in California rooms, especially the ones you visit often you should tip the chiprunner and in the high limit section often the floor (this depends on how large the high limit section is where the floor is often also the one running the board). The floor will be on your side on disputes, will give you good games and if you are really high roller will even call you when some whale might come in. At WSOP don't get the chips yourself! Chiprunner all the way.

I would really discourage anybody from getting the poker room rate. If you must get a reduced rate at all, you should get the casino rate and just play some 500$ coin-in Video Poker at a -20$ EV or some EV neutral blackjack. Poker room rates bind you to a certain play (usually way too much for my taste) and the rate sucks as it's the rack rate.
